Why Alternatives Matter in 2025
From tech demos to real production
The most important shift is that text-to-video has moved from "technology demonstration" to "real commercial use." Early models produced impressive clips that fell apart on close inspection: objects changed shape mid-scene, characters morphed between shots, and physics behaved strangely. The latest generation of tools focuses on fixing exactly those problems, offering more structural control and better scene coherence.
For creators, this changes the calculation. A tool is no longer just a toy for making viral clips; it is part of a production pipeline. That means reliability, consistency, and control matter as much as raw visual quality.
The problem with depending on one model
Every model has strengths and weaknesses. One might be exceptional at photorealistic people but weak at fast motion. Another might excel at stylized animation but struggle with realistic lighting. If your workflow depends on a single model, you are stuck with its limitations.
The strongest alternative platforms solve this by offering a library of models. Instead of forcing every task through one engine, you can pick the best tool for each shot: a realism-focused model for product footage, an anime-tuned model for character scenes, a fast model for drafts and storyboards. This flexibility is the core advantage of multi-model platforms over single-model tools.
What to Look for in a Text-to-Video Tool
Scene coherence
The biggest frustration in AI video is scene incoherence: the background changes between shots, the lighting shifts without reason, or the geometry of a room warps. Good tools give you structural controls — reference frames, camera instructions, and style anchors — that keep the scene stable across generations.
Character consistency
Character inconsistency is the other classic failure mode. The same character should look like the same person in every shot, not a distant relative. Look for tools that support character references, custom training, or image-to-video workflows where you provide a base image of the character. These features are the difference between a usable production asset and a collection of unrelated clips.
Model flexibility
As discussed, a library of models beats a single engine for serious work. When you evaluate a platform, check whether you can switch models per task and whether the library is regularly updated with new state-of-the-art options.
Workflow support
For professional use, look beyond the generation screen. Does the tool support batch generation, API access, project organization, and integration with your existing editing tools? A beautiful generator with a clunky workflow will slow you down more than a slightly weaker model with excellent pipeline support.
Cost transparency
Generation costs vary widely. Look for platforms with clear, predictable costs and free or cheap tiers for testing. If a tool only offers enterprise sales and no self-serve option, it is probably not designed for individual creators yet.

Practical Workflows
Building a character-driven series
If you are producing a series with the same protagonist, start by establishing a character reference image. Use image-to-video generation to animate that character, rather than describing them from scratch in text. This single practice eliminates most character inconsistency problems.
Prototyping before final renders
Use fast, cheap models for storyboards and drafts. Lock the narrative and shot list first, then render final shots with premium models. This workflow saves significant time and budget compared to rendering everything at maximum quality from the start.
Mixing styles deliberately
Multi-model platforms shine when you mix styles on purpose. A documentary-style opening, an animated explainer middle, and a photorealistic product close can all live in one project. Just be deliberate about it — unintentional style jumps look like errors, intentional ones look like direction.
Building a reusable asset library
As you work, save your best reference images, character sheets, and prompt templates. A small personal library of proven assets turns every new project from a blank slate into a fast assembly job. Creators who build this habit produce work faster and more consistently than those who start from scratch each time.
Managing Cost and Budget
Generation costs vary dramatically between models and platforms. The practical approach is to plan at the project level: estimate how many shots you need, which quality tier each shot requires, and what your total budget allows. Render test clips before committing to full scenes, and keep re-renders under control by locking prompts and references before the final pass.
A sensible budget rule for most projects is to spend roughly twenty percent of the budget on drafts and tests, then reserve the rest for final renders. If a scene does not work in a cheap draft, a premium render will not save it — fix the story and composition first.
Evaluating Tools With a Test Project
The only reliable way to compare text-to-video platforms is to run the same small project through each candidate. Pick a test brief with three requirements: a consistent character, a stable environment, and one dynamic action shot. Generate the same scenes in each tool, then compare:
- How closely the character matches across shots.
- Whether the environment stays stable between generations.
- How well fast motion holds up without distortion.
- How many re-renders each tool required.
- The total time and cost of the test.
Keep a simple scorecard. After two or three tools, the differences become obvious, and the platform that feels right for your specific work will reveal itself. Tool reviews and demo reels are useful for shortlists, but nothing replaces testing on your own material.
Building a Sustainable Workflow
Keep a prompt library
Save prompts that work. A well-organized library of prompts, reference images, and settings becomes your personal production asset, making future projects dramatically faster.
Version your assets
Name files systematically, keep original generations separate from edited versions, and store reference images in a shared folder. When a client asks for a variation of a shot from three months ago, you will be glad you did.
Document what works
Note which models performed best for which tasks. Over time, this becomes a practical playbook that saves hours of trial and error.
Common Mistakes to Avoid
- Rendering everything at maximum quality before the story is locked.
- Describing characters from scratch in every prompt instead of using references.
- Judging tools by one viral demo instead of testing them on your own project.
- Ignoring licensing terms and discovering commercial restrictions too late.
- Switching platforms constantly without building a consistent workflow.
Avoiding these five mistakes matters more than which platform you choose.
Working With a Team
If you produce video with a team, build the workflow around shared assets. A central folder of character references, style guides, and approved prompts keeps everyone generating in the same visual direction. Without shared references, each team member produces slightly different versions of the same brand, and the inconsistency shows up in the final edit.
Assign clear roles: someone owns the visual references, someone owns the prompts and model selection, someone reviews output against the brief. This division of labor is the practical difference between a team that generates clips and a team that produces campaigns. As the team grows, document everything — a new member should be able to pick up the workflow from written notes rather than by interrupting colleagues.
FAQ
Is Sora still the best text-to-video tool?
Sora sets the bar for realism, but "best" depends on your needs. For character consistency, style control, and flexible workflows, multi-model alternatives often serve creators better.
Do I need a powerful computer to use these tools?
Most text-to-video tools run in the cloud, so your local hardware matters less than your internet connection and budget. Heavy local editing still benefits from a decent GPU, but generation itself is server-side.
Can I use text-to-video for commercial projects?
Yes, but check the licensing terms of each platform. Commercial use rights vary, and some models restrict what you can do with generated content.
How do I keep characters consistent across shots?
Use character reference images and image-to-video workflows instead of describing characters in text. Custom model training, where available, gives the strongest consistency.
What is the biggest mistake beginners make?
Generating everything at maximum quality with one model. Start with fast models for drafts, lock your story, and reserve premium models for the shots that need them.
How much does text-to-video cost?
It varies widely, from free tiers with watermarks to per-second rates on premium models. Estimate your monthly shot count and test on a small batch before committing to a subscription.
